Hi, I have an indesit idl530 dishwasher that was working perfectly well until we renovated the kitchen.
I reinstalled the dishwasher in a different location but continued to use the same fill connector and discharge point but on first use the first and third leds were flashing, indicating a discharge blockage and yes found the pipe was crimped preventing discharge but having resolved this problem it now has the second and fourth led flashing indicating a heating problem, I have checked all internal connections and checked the element at 27 ohms.
I contacted the indesit helpdesk who told me to turn off the machine for five minutes then retry, this proved futile, is there a reset procedure to follow after errors?

I would really appreciate any help.

Does the lights flash straight away or half way during the wash
 
Hi, the leds come on after about 30 seconds from switch on as the water is input.
 
Heater relay has gone open curcuit on the pcb.
 
Sponsored Links
Thanks for that Rocks, replaced relay still same problem, now decided to remove pumps etc and sell on ebay, buying a new dishwasher.
